Biographical Information:
City of Residence: Pensacola
Occupation:Realtor and Property Management
Child(ren): Benjamin
Education: Pensacola Junior College, A.A., 1982, student government, student activities; University of West Florida, B.S., Political Science, 1991, Sigma Alpha Epsilon Fraternity, student activities, Campus Alcohol & Drug Information Center, Sailing Club
Born: December 24, 1963, Louisville, KY
Moved to Florida: 1978
Religious Affiliation: Lutheran
Recreational Interest: current events, politics
Legislative Service:
Elected to the House in 2002, reelected subsequently
